Learn more about Angel Fire

Carved into the Sangre de Cristo Mountains, this alpine retreat transforms with the seasons. In winter, Angel Fire Resort's slopes beckon skiers and snowboarders to pristine powder. Summer brings mountain bikers tackling rugged trails while golfers tee off against dramatic mountain backdrops. Monte Verde Lake offers peaceful fishing moments. The Vietnam Veterans Memorial provides a moving counterpoint to outdoor adventures. Explore nearby Cimarron Canyon State Park or venture into Carson National Forest. The Enchanted Circle Scenic Byway reveals vistas that have drawn artists to these mountains for generations. For a small resort town, this four-season playground delivers outsized experiences without the crowds of better-known mountain destinations.

What will the weather in Angel Fire be like during my visit?
July and June are typically the warmest months in Angel Fire, when the average temperature is 16°C. January and February are the coldest months, when the average temperature is -3°C. July and August are the months with the most rain.

Top locations to stay in Angel Fire

Some of the best areas to stay in when visiting Angel Fire, New Mexico, are Eagle Nest, Valle Escondido, and Taos. Eagle Nest offers beautiful lakes and mountain views, Valle Escondido boasts scenic golf courses and tranquil surroundings, while Taos is renowned for its vibrant art scene and skiing opportunities. For first-time visitors, Taos is the most appealing choice.

  1. TaosOpens in a new window: Taos is a vibrant destination known for its rich artistic heritage and stunning landscapes. Art enthusiasts will adore the numerous galleries and cultural attractions that showcase local talent. The area is also home to exceptional skiing opportunities in winter, making it a popular choice for outdoor lovers. With a variety of shops, you can find unique handmade crafts and local artisanal products. The town's charming adobe architecture adds to its allure, inviting visitors to stroll through its historic streets and enjoy the captivating scenery.
  2. Eagle NestOpens in a new window: Nestled by a beautiful lake, Eagle Nest is perfect for those seeking tranquility and outdoor adventure. This quaint town offers fantastic fishing, hiking, and boating opportunities in the summer months. The pristine surroundings provide a picturesque backdrop for relaxing getaways. Eagle Nest is also close to the scenic Enchanted Circle drive, making it easy to explore the stunning landscapes of northern New Mexico. It's a great base for experiencing the natural beauty of the area.

Best time to go to Angel Fire

Angel Fire exper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 22.6°F (-5.2°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 63.5°F (17.5°C). July is usually the wettest month. January, February, and December are the peak travel months in Angel Fire,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by no rainfall. On the other hand, April, May, and August t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by no to light rainfall and sunny conditions.
